No Bake Lemon Pie Recipe

  • Total Time: 4 hours 15 minutes
  • Yield: 8 1x

Description

Creamy lemon pie delivers a refreshing citrus escape without turning on the oven. Cool, zesty layers of smooth filling and graham cracker crust promise a delightful dessert you’ll savor with each tangy bite.


Ingredients

Scale

Primary Ingredients (Filling):

  • 1 (14 oz / 396 g) can sweetened condensed milk
  • ½ cup (120 ml) fresh lemon juice
  • 1 tablespoon lemon zest
  • 1 cup (240 ml) heavy whipping cream

Crust Ingredients:

  • 1 ½ cups (150 g) graham cracker crumbs
  • ¼ cup (50 g) granulated sugar
  • 6 tablespoons (85 g) unsalted butter, melted

Optional Topping Ingredients:

  • Whipped cream
  • Lemon slices or zest

Instructions

  1. Craft a crumbly foundation by thoroughly blending graham cracker crumbs with sugar and melted butter until the texture mimics damp sand particles.
  2. Press the graham mixture meticulously into every contour of a 9-inch pie dish, ensuring an even and compact layer that reaches both bottom and sides.
  3. Temporarily park the crust in the refrigerator, allowing it to solidify and maintain its structured shape for approximately half an hour.
  4. Combine sweetened condensed milk with freshly squeezed lemon juice and delicate lemon zest in a spacious mixing vessel, whisking until the mixture transforms into a silky, homogeneous consistency.
  5. Introduce billowy whipped cream into the lemony base, folding gently to preserve its airy volume and create a light, luxurious filling.
  6. Transfer the vibrant lemon cream into the chilled crust, using a spatula to distribute the filling uniformly and eliminate any potential air pockets.
  7. Relocate the assembled pie to the refrigerator, permitting it to rest and set completely for a minimum of four hours until the filling achieves a firm, elegant texture.
  8. Before serving, consider adorning the pie with delicate dollops of whipped cream, petite lemon slice medallions, or a sprinkle of additional lemon zest for a sophisticated presentation.

Notes

  • Enhance the crust’s flavor by toasting graham cracker crumbs in a dry skillet for a few minutes before mixing, which adds a deeper, nuttier taste to the base.
  • Ensure lemon filling’s perfect consistency by using freshly squeezed lemon juice and zest, avoiding bottled juice that can make the texture less vibrant and zingy.
  • Customize the pie for dietary needs by substituting graham crackers with gluten-free alternatives like almond flour or crushed gluten-free cookies for a celiac-friendly version.
  • Elevate the dessert’s presentation by creating decorative patterns with whipped cream using a piping bag, or sprinkling candied lemon peel for an elegant, professional touch.
